Watching Porn Is a Guy Thing

In 2009, researchers in Montreal were trying to do a study of men in their twenties. They wanted to compare the view of men who had never watched pornography to those who regularly did. There was one problem. They couldn’t find a single man who had never watched porn.

This was a small study, and these results were repeated for the most part only in the lay media, but they perpetuate two stereotypes: 1) all men watch porn, and 2) porn is a guy thing.

Let’s start with the first question. How many men do watch porn? One of the most comprehensive studies around was just recently published, and used data from the General Social Survey, which is a massive national survey funded by the National Science Foundation that has been collecting data on social beliefs and behaviors of people in the United States since 1973. Researchers took a look at results from this survey from then until 2010. Over the nearly three decades, that included more than 14,000 males in the United States.

Now, before we look at the results, it’s time for some truth. We totally believed that the results of the Montreal researchers would have been proven true writ large. Have you been on the Internet lately? Some days it seems impossible not to see porn. But we were willing to put aside our biases and look at the evidence.

We were shocked. In 2010, only 36 percent of men reported having watched at least one pornographic film in the last year. In 1973, that number was 31 percent. With some minor fluctuations to a low of 20 percent in 1980 and a high of 30 percent in 1987, that number hasn’t changed that much. Over all the years, the percent of men who responded affirmatively was about 32 percent.

When you look at these numbers, one thing you have to remember is that lots of men are older men. And the older you are, the less likely you are to watch pornography. Whites are slightly less likely to consume pornography than males in minority groups. And people who are more religious are slightly less likely to watch pornography as well.

This isn’t to say that pornography isn’t a huge business. Video pornography was generating more than $10 billion a year more than a decade ago. That number has only increased since then.

So are these low numbers even possible? Doesn’t everyone watch porn?

It turns out the answer is no. In 2005, researchers reported that only 14 percent of people reported ever having explicitly visited a sexual Web site. We know that sounds hard to believe. You have to remember, though, that the Internet use skews young. It’s likely your grandparents aren’t trolling the Web for porn. Lots of people are in that age demographic. And even among younger people, it’s not as frequent as conventional wisdom might have you believe.
